Tether Launches Developer Grants Program To Fund Local-First AI And Payment Infrastructure

Technology firm Tether introduced the launch of a brand new grants program aimed toward supporting builders engaged on its open know-how stack, with funding distributed in line with particular technical deliverables quite than a hard and fast total cap. The program is now open for functions, with builders in a position to choose and contribute to energetic growth duties.

Grants are issued in USD₮ or Bitcoin and are supposed to help the event of infrastructure elements resembling pockets methods, browser extensions, and e-commerce integration instruments. Payouts are structured on a task-completion foundation, with present rewards ranging roughly between $1,500 and $4,000 per accomplished project, quite than by means of conventional open-ended analysis funding.

A key focus of the initiative is a broader shift away from cloud-reliant synthetic intelligence methods and API-dependent monetary infrastructure. Many present AI fashions proceed to depend on distant server processing, requiring information to be transmitted externally, which might introduce latency, extra prices, and elevated publicity of delicate data. As a part of its funding efforts, Tether is supporting the event of QVAC, a platform designed to carry out AI inference immediately on person units, lowering dependence on centralized exterior suppliers.

An analogous dependency construction is recognized throughout the crypto utility layer, the place on-chain asset transfers have change into more and more accessible whereas full utility independence stays restricted. Many growth environments nonetheless require reliance on custodial providers, exchanges, or third-party APIs to allow core performance resembling pockets creation, cost processing, and information entry. These exterior dependencies can introduce operational constraints and factors of management outdoors the applying itself.

Advancing Wallet Infrastructure, Decentralized Development, And Web3 Ecosystem Tools

In order to handle this, a part of the grant program is directed towards the event of the Wallet Development Kit (WDK), an open-source framework designed to permit self-custodial pockets performance to be embedded immediately into functions. The toolkit permits native key era, transaction signing, and asset transfers with out reliance on custodial intermediaries or hosted API infrastructure. It is designed to be used throughout cell, desktop, and embedded environments, permitting cost and asset administration capabilities to be built-in immediately into software program methods. Because execution happens regionally, the framework is meant to help each user-facing functions and automatic machine-driven environments with out requiring exterior infrastructure dependencies.

The grant construction is organized round a number of technical focus areas, together with the event of core libraries for QVAC, MDK, WDK, and Pears, the creation of documentation and onboarding supplies, application-layer growth constructed on Tether’s know-how stack, and analysis into decentralization, edge computing, peer-to-peer networking, and cryptography. Additional funding is allotted to tooling, integrations, and open requirements growth. Each grant is outlined by a selected activity, with predetermined deadlines and stuck compensation.

The initiative extends Tether’s ongoing involvement in funding open-source growth, Bitcoin schooling, and decentralized infrastructure initiatives. Previous contributions have included consecutive annual grants of $100,000 to the BTCPay Server Foundation, a $250,000 donation to OpenSats supporting Bitcoin and open-source builders, and participation within the Plan₿ initiative in collaboration with the City of Lugano. Through this program, greater than 500 pupil schooling grants have been distributed, alongside funding for annual pitch competitions, with as much as CHF 5 million allotted for continued growth by means of 2030.
